Kinds Of Window Protection


To efficiently safeguard windows, different approaches and materials can be used. These choices variety from physical barriers to innovative technologies. Below are some of the most common kinds of window protection:

Type of Protection

Description

Window Films

Thin, transparent films that comply with the glass, offering UV protection, shatter resistance, and lowered glare.

Security Screens

Resilient screens made of stainless-steel or aluminum wire mesh that offer a barrier against intruders while preserving exposure.

Shutters

Solid or accordion-style shutters that can be closed over windows to protect from effects and entry.

Storm Windows

Additional panes that can be closed during serious weather condition to safeguard versus high winds and debris.

Window Bars

Metal bars that are installed over windows to hinder break-ins.

Enhanced Glass

Glass that is crafted to withstand shattering and breaking, often used in high-security environments.

Advantages of Window Protection

Carrying out efficient window protection offers many benefits. Some of the essential benefits consist of:

  1. Enhanced Security: By making entry more difficult, window protection prevents possible trespassers and lowers the likelihood of burglary.
  2. Weather condition Resistance: Protects versus extreme weather and flying debris, guaranteeing the stability of windows during storms.
  3. UV Protection: Window movies can obstruct hazardous UV rays, safeguarding interior furnishings and fixtures from fading.
  4. Energy Efficiency: Certain protective measures, like window movies and storm windows, can improve insulation, resulting in lower energy expenses.
  5. Aesthetic Appeal: Many window protection choices improve the general visual of a property, providing extra beauty and value.

FAQs on Window Protection


1. Are window films effective for security?

Yes, window movies can provide a layer of shatter resistance, making it harder for burglars to break through. Secure Door And Window provide UV protection and can reduce glare, contributing to their efficiency.

2. Can I set up window bars on all types of windows?

While window bars can be installed on many types of windows, particular local regulations might limit their usage. Always consult local authorities or a professional before setups.

3. Just how much does window protection cost?

The cost of window protection differs extensively based on the approach picked. Window movies might start at a few dollars per square foot, while security screens and shutters can vary from hundreds to thousands of dollars, depending on quality and setup intricacy.

4. Will window protection decrease natural light?

Certain window protection approaches, like films and shutters, can reduce natural light to some extent. Nevertheless, lots of contemporary movies are developed to reduce this effect while still supplying effective protection.

5. How often should I check my window protection systems?

Regular inspections are advised, ideally bi-annually or quarterly, particularly after extreme weather condition. Guarantee that all systems are operating appropriately which no damage or wear is visible.
